Finio-Dhannic
| This entry contains reconstructed words and roots. As such, the term(s) in this entry are not directly attested, but are hypothesized to have existed based on comparative evidence. |
Etymology
From Proto-Lúsanic dṓnon, from Proto-Indo-European *deh₃nom. Ultimately from the root *deh₃-, meaning to give.
Pronunciation
- (Reconstructed) IPA: /ˈdo.non/
Noun
donon (plural dona)
- A gift.
